Self-discipline

Personality Development                                             

On numerous occasions people talk about the importance of having self-discipline.

Self-discipline is not something that we are born with. It is a learned behavior. It requires practice and repetition in our day-to-day life. Commitment is one of the keys to self-discipline.

Everybody will have ups and downs, fabulous successes, and flat out failures.

It is easy to get wrapped up in guilt, anger, or frustration, but these emotions will not help to improve self-discipline.

Improved self-discipline will allow us to live a freer life by helping us to make healthy choices and not emotional ones.

Measuring the current results against past results can be an effective method that helps to stay focused, motivated and disciplined.

That is the only way to ensure that a person will have enough long-term staying power to stick with goal.

There are many important qualities that can contribute to a person’s achievements and happiness, but there is only one that begets sustainable, long-term success in all aspects of life ie, self-discipline.

Aiyan Thiruvalluvar says

ஒழுக்கம் விழுப்பந் தரலான் ஒழுக்கம்
உயிரினும் ஓம்பப் படும்(131)

सदाचार-संपन्नता, देती सब को श्रेय ।
तब तो प्राणों से अधिक, रक्षणीय वह ज्ञेय ॥ (१३१)

Explanation by Scholars:

Propriety of conduct leads to eminence. It should therefore be preserved more carefully than life.

Building Self-Confidence

Personality Development          

Self-confidence is extremely important in almost every aspect of our lives, yet so many people struggle to find it. People who lack self-confidence can find it difficult to become successful. If you are under-confident,  you’ll avoid taking risks and stretching yourself and you might not try at all.

One  might be persuaded to consider accepting a project by someone who speaks clearly, who holds his or her head high, who answers questions assuredly, and who readily admits when he or she does not know something. 
Confident people inspire confidence in others: their audience, peers, bosses, customers and friends.

Two main things contribute to self-confidence: self-efficacy and self-esteem. 
We gain a sense of self-efficacy  when we see ourselves mastering skills and achieving goals that matter in those skill areas. Self-esteem is that we can cope with what's going on in our lives, and that we have a right to be happy.

With the right amount of self-confidence, you will take informed risks, stretch yourself and try hard.

Aiyan Thiruvalluvar explains about Building Self-Confidence.

அருமை உடைத்தென்று அசாவாமை வேண்டும் 
பெருமை முயற்சி தரும்.  (611)

दुष्कर यह यों समझकर, होना नहीं निरास ।
जानो योग्य महानता, देगा सतत प्रयास ॥ (६११)

Explanation by Scholars: 

Yield not to the feebleness which says, "this is too difficult to be done".  Effort will give the greatness of mind (self-confidence) which is necessary to do it.

Ego

Personality Development
Every one of us has a dominant negative attitude, a defensive and potentially destructive pattern of thinking, feeling and acting which is known as Ego. It is a constraining factor or personal stumbling block.
The main reasons are self destruction, undervaluing oneself, denying responsibility, resisting to change, greed, arrogance and impatience. It can occur when someone is in a leadership position and loses perspective about his/her role in the organization.
A leader tends to garner large amounts of praise and recognition for successes both from those outside an organization and from within the organization. This is particularly problematic in situations where the leader sets up an internal organizational culture that supports communicating about positive things. It is true that some leaders succeed due to being in the right place at the right time with the right skills. But when situations change, the leaders who do not change along with the situations due to ego will tend to self-destruct. In ego-driven leaders, purpose takes a distant backseat to personal success.
The ego is one of the biggest barriers to people working together effectively. When people get caught up in their egos, it erodes their effectiveness. It is because the combination of false pride and self-doubt created by an overactive ego gives people a distorted image of their own importance. When we are told that we are wrong, we often resent it. 
Our opposition to the refutation of our misconceptions frequently stems from our ego, the part of us that insists on its correctness. The ego is not the enemy to be subdued but a compilation of unexamined habits that keep us from greatness.
When we allow ego to lead the way, we are edging out greatness. Ego is the mask we wear to cover it all up. Ego is not about power. It is about being powerless. 
Aiyan Thiruvalluvar says
வெண்மை எனப்படுவ தியாதெனின் ஒண்மை 
உடையம்யாம் என்னும் செருக்கு. (844)

हीन-बुद्धि किसको कहें, यदि पूछोगे बात ।
स्वयं मान ‘हम हैं सुधी’, भ्रम में पड़ना ज्ञात ॥ (८४४)
Explanation by Scholars
What is called want of wisdom is the vanity which says, "We are wise".

Multitasking

Personality Development                                   
Multitasking is an apparent human ability to perform more than one task, or activity, over a short period. 
Persons faced with converging deadlines, are often required to work on several tasks simultaneously. Multitasking is generally looked on as a positive concept.
Those skilled in the practice are said to be able to move fluidly and quickly between different areas of work without losing overview or focus. 
Modern technological advances have made multi-tasking both unavoidable and necessary.

Multitasking prevents an employee becoming bored with repetitive tasks and also means they are exposed to a host of different work which can increase their knowledge and skills.
Multitasking employees certainly increase the productivity of the organization. They deliver more output with minimum resources.
Employees with multitasking abilities have better chances of survival than others even in the worst situations. Multitasking can be a useful way of ensuring that several tasks can be worked on in the same period and prevent downtime.
Should an employee be unable to move on with a certain task, for example when waiting on feedback from another department, they can move quickly into another task which requires attention. This means that an employee is fully utilized within the business.
Multitasking has become a common term not only in today’s busy organizations but also during Aiyan’s era.
Aiyan Thiruvalluvar says
வினையான் வினையாக்கிக் கோடல் நனைகவுள் 
யானையால்  யானையாத் தற்று. (678)

एक कर्म करते हुए, और कर्म हो जाय ।
मद गज से मद-मत्त गज, जैसे पकड़ा जाय ॥ (६७८)

Explanation by Scholars: 
To make one undertaking the means of accomplishing another (similar to it) is like making one rutting elephant the means of capturing another.

Maintain the Secrecy

Personality Development                                  

Secrecy is the practice of hiding information while sharing it with others. Shouldn't you announce your goals, so friends can support you? Isn't it good networking to tell people about your upcoming projects?
Answer: No.
Once you've told people of your intentions, it gives you a "premature sense of completeness."
People who talk about their intentions are less likely to make them happen. Announcing your plans to others may satisfy your self-identity.
Different tests found that those who kept their intentions private were more likely to achieve them than those who made them public.
It may seem unnatural to keep your intentions and plans private.
Announcing your plans before achieving/completion makes you less motivated and will create more problems.
Aiyan Thiruvalluvar says
கடைக்கொட்கச் செய்தக்க தாண்மை இடைக்கொட்கின்
எற்றா விழுமந் தரும். (663)

प्रकट किया कर्मान्त में, तो है योग्य सुधीर ।
प्रकट किया यदि बीच में, देगा अनन्त पीर ॥ (६६३)

Explanation by Scholars

So to perform an act as to publish it (only) at its termination is (true) manliness; for to announce it beforehand, will cause irremediable sorrow.
கடைக்கொட்க = At completion stage
செய்தக்க தாண்மை =  perform an act as to publish
இடைக்கொட்கின் = for to announce it beforehand
எற்றா விழுமந் தரும் = will cause irremediable sorrow

Laziness

Personality Development                            

Laziness can lead to total failure in a person's life. It has a bad effect on our physical and mental health.

Laziness is the biggest enemy of life. If a person is lazy then he will not acquire any significant position in his life and will always remain confused.

Laziness is a disease which slowly steals everything from us.

The biggest attribute of laziness is that we don't understand its ill-effects on the right time, and afterwards we can only regret.

Laziness not only leads to mental disorders but it also affects our body and health.

The lazy persons become less efficient and the energy level of the person becomes down.

The brain of lazy persons do not function properly. They have a weak memory. They take much time to answer any question.

To become intelligent, skillful and efficient we should quit laziness first.

Laziness has killed careers, futures, relationships, families, friendships, you name it and there has been at least one case where laziness played a large role, and effort played none.

Aiyan Thiruvalluvar says

நெடுநீர் மறவி மடிதுயில் நான்கும்
கெடுநீரார் காமக் கலன். (605)

दीर्घसूत्रता, विस्मरण, सुस्ती, निद्रा-चाव ।
जो जन चाहें डूबना, चारों हैं प्रिय नाव ॥ (६०५)

Explanation by Scholars

Procrastination, forgetfulness, idleness, and sleep, these four things, form the vessel which is desired by those destined to destruction.
